During a photoshoot at Symbio Wildlife Park, a monarch butterfly perched itself on the schnoz of Willow the koala, as she prepped for her close up.
A spokesperson for the park told ABCthat Willow wasn't fussed sharing the spotlight though, saying "Willow came running over and starting getting really inquisitive, nuzzling up to it. Before we knew it, it actually flew onto Willow's head and then stayed there for ages."
Home invasion isn't really a cute subject, but when the invader is a lost koala it's less terrifying and more of a funny surprise.
14-year-old Nicholas Sneath was reading in bed when he heard a noise outside his bedroom door. That noise turned out to be a slightly lost koala turned home intruder.
After a car accident left him orphaned, 9-month-old koala joey Shayne was cared for by Australia Zoo's wildlife warriors.
Part of that rehabilitation process saw him find comfort in a stuffed toy in his likeness and the rest is the stuff Disney films are made of.
Little Mason of Port Stephens Koala Sanctuary seems to have forgotten how trees work, because he ran straight into one.
The first known instance of identical joeys was only recorded in 2000 at the University of Queensland, Australia, making this teensy duo who live in the bush outside of Raymond Island's Koala and Wildlife Shelter extra special.
When Victorian MP Harriet Shing was driving down the main street she didn't expect to see a curious koala.
After guiding it across the road, the inquisitive koala proceeded to head toward a nearby accountant's, probably to make sure its taxes were in order. Maybe.
This fella wandered into Nikki Erickson's house while Erickson was at work in June. Making good use of her doggie door, the koala, whether intentional or not, has a nice little routine going on.
